Mad man Roger Sterling and girl Peggy Olsen can be pleased with the advertising ingenuity behind Vega Sports’ trifecta of workout merchandise: Prepare, Sustain and Recover. What are they? They are functional drinks bought as powders (to be combined with water) that function earlier than, during and after train sustenance and support. The former product "Prepare" is the type of genius advertising and marketing solely a artistic director like Peggy Olsen-assigned by Sterling, of course-might invent. Vega claims this product will make you more energized, targeted, and ready to take in your work out-versus going at it as your raw, normal self. Vega, and plenty of companies prefer it, has created a need within the fitness world where there wasn’t one earlier than: convincing yuppie hipsters and the like they need power elixirs to gasoline-up their physical activity. But for nourished adults who train regularly and are not coaching for an Ironman Triathlon, the body doesn’t want an out of doors gas supply, be it a Fitmiss Ignite, a Rockstar Energy Drink, a fast Twitch or any of the various other pre-workout drinks.
